The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Michael Gettens, born in 1844 in , consisted of 3 members. Michael was the head of the household, married to Janet Gettens, born in 1857 in Dumbarton, Dunbartonshire, Scotland. They had 1 child; Catherine, born 1881 in Greenock, Renfrewshire, Scotland.
